Centralia, Wa vs Villa Dolores Climate & Distance Between

Argentina flag
  • The distance between Centralia, Wa, Usa and Villa Dolores, Argentina is approximately 10,513 km or 6,533 mi.
  • To reach Centralia, Wa in this distance one would set out from Villa Dolores bearing 324.6°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Centralia, Wa bearing 313.9° or NW .
  • Centralia, Wa has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b) whereas Villa Dolores has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h).
  • Centralia, Wa is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Villa Dolores is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 7.9 °C (14.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0 °C (0°F) more in Centralia, Wa.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 584.3 mm (23 in) more which is equivalent to 584.3 l/m² (14.34 US gal/ft²) or 5,843,000 l/ha (624,655 US gal/ac) more. About 2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.3° lower in Centralia, Wa than in Villa Dolores.
